Alphonso Mango Pulp is a premium quality mango puree that captures the unique flavors of the sought-after Alphonso mango from different regions. This product offers a range of varieties including Southern Alphonso (Brix 16), Western Alphonso (Brix 17), and Ratnagiri Alphonso (Brix 18), each having a distinct sweetness level perfect for diverse culinary applications. Available in multiple packaging formats such as aseptic 215 kg and 20 kg Bag-In-Box (BIB), frozen drums, and canned options, Alphonso Mango Pulp is ideal for manufacturers in the food and beverage industry looking to incorporate authentic mango flavor into their products. Its high Brix value ensures rich taste and consistent quality, making it a versatile ingredient for juices, desserts, ice creams, bakery fillings, and sauces. Suitable for bulk buyers and food processing units, this mango pulp delivers the natural aroma and taste of Alphonso mangoes with the convenience of ready-to-use packaging.
